In-Text Add, that inobedience to this call of Christ, there do some come dayly from thence, and in truth how could our Saviour, call his people from thence if he had none there? How could the Apostles say that Antichrist from whose captivity they are called shall sit in the Temple of God (since that Ierusalem is finally and utterly desolated) unless the same Apostle otherwhere declaring himself had shewed us his meaning, that the Church is the house of God, and again, ye are the Temple of the living God, and the Temple of God is Holy, which are ye; Add, that inobedience to this call of christ, there do Some come daily from thence, and in truth how could our Saviour, call his people from thence if he had none there?
